Eureka! Thanks for the photo.

That must be what is behind the side of my battery. Just the other day, I noticed there was battery cables going to something behind the battery, and I was not sure what it was as there is no way I can get to it without taking the battery out, and it has been too cold to investigate further.

Those are familiar to me as they come from the boating world. It looks like a Blue Sea series 285. I just bought one to put on the hydraulic lift circuit as they put in an auto-reset breaker, which while it will protect the circuit, will not allow you to disconnect it (you push in the red part to trip it).



I am going to re-wire the battery box area this year. I am going to replace the batteries, and I want to clean up the entire Rube Goldberg mess.

I am thinking of installing one of these hatches to the outside of the coach:



I want to put both the disconnect for the hydraulic lifters in there, as well as the one Thor put behind the battery, if indeed that is what it is. And if I have room, perhaps a solar battery charger plug.

But if I go this route, I need to make sure the existing cables will be long enough as I really don't want to run new cables. And I will probably have to buy thru-mount versions of the breakers as the existing ones are surface mount. And at $40 bucks per breaker, they ain't cheap.
